Transaction: ecb3b68f443005ba6a162425e427431e9e94ed4493065d4f1e8bbbb6e7995b2c

Block Hash: e3ac7a67178576c79b77bac91e3936cf61200285ddd2f47eb658f7c9783c53a6

Confirmations: 3362416

Timestamp: 2016-04-17 22:36:31

Amount: 12.922827999999999

Is Block Reward: No

Inputs

Sender Address Amount
SefSLwPsrPz8jXcfRpNGLvF3nvxvCbpxgn 12.85

Outputs

Recipient Address Amount
SefSLwPsrPz8jXcfRpNGLvF3nvxvCbpxgn 12.922827999999999